Warning Signs You Need Bathroom Water Damage Restoration

Bathroom water damage can be unpredictable and sneaky. It’s essential to catch the warning signs early to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Here are some common signs that you need bathroom water damage restoration: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ty odors in your bathroom can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ent smell that won’t go away,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and provide a solution to fix it.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your flooring is uneven or damaged, it’s essential to address the issue immediately. Our team can help you repair or replace your flooring to prevent further damage.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ains on ceilings and wal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any water stains,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source of the stain and provide a solution to fix it.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it’s essential to address the issue immediately. Our team can help you repair or replace your paint or wallpaper to prevent further damage.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th in your bathroom can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any mold or mildew growth, it’s essential to address the issue immediately. Our team can help you remove the mold or mildew and provide a solution to prevent future growth.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ill Yes No You can likely fix the issue yourself with a mop and some towels.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ment to extract the water and dry the area.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ment to repair or replace the flooring.
Mold or mildew growth No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ment to remove the mold or mildew and prevent future growth.
Water damage from a flood No Yes You’ll need specialized equipment to extract the water and dry the area, and to repair or replace any damaged materials.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Weiser Junction, ID

The cost of bathroom water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Weiser Junction, ID. Here are some estimated costs for common bathroom water damage restoration services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age.
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ning solutions used.
Repair and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air.
Mold or mildew removal $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used.
Water damage restoration (complete) $2,000 – $10,000 The size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and the local conditions in Weiser Junction, ID.

Remember, these estimates are based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Weiser Junction, ID. The actual cost of bathroom water damage restoration may vary. We offer free estimates to help you understand the costs involved.
